Computers: An Afterschool Necessity for Many Young Students
(NewsUSA) - Shopping for school supplies isn't what it used to be. Sure, kids still need notebooks, binders and pens -- but they won't survive without the latest technology either, namely a computer. According to a recent survey commissioned by HP and conducted by Wakefield Research, computers become a significant part of homework assignments for children as young as 10 years old and students aged 6 to 17 spend at least three hours a day on devices with Internet access. However, that much computer use at such a young age raises some concerns among parents. "If your child is about to hit double digits, computers are going to be a routine part of their afterschool homework," explains Kevin Frost, Vice President, Volume Business Unit, HP. "HP shares parents' online safety concerns and offers a variety of desktop and notebook PCs with some exclusive offers and deals for students getting ready to go back to school." Can kids have fun and be safe online? Most parents want to guarantee safety instead of hoping for it. The survey reported that more than 28 percent of parents have more faith in giving their child a credit card at the mall than leaving them home alone on a computer. In fact, over a third of parents surveyed believe children cruising the Internet unsupervised have more potential for danger than kids staying at a friend's house without parental supervision. Despite these fears -- and the reality that prolonged computer usage is the norm for many students -- 66 percent of parents don't take simple steps to protect their children online, such as using parental control software, and 67 percent don't block websites they deem inappropriate. To keep your children safe while making sure they're able to complete their school work, consider the following from HP: * Select the right computer. To keep an eye on young children's computer use, consider a family desktop PC that you can keep in a centralized location in your home. For example, HP has two desktops with student-friendly features and a 60-day Norton Internet Security trial -- the Pavilion 23 All-in-One and TouchSmart 320 All-in-One (www.shopping.hp.com). * Use parental control software. Be aware of what your kids are doing online, by setting time limits and restricting inappropriate websites. Select HP PCs come with up to two years of Norton Internet Security at no charge. * Talk to your kids. Your kids may be "digitally savvy," but that doesn't mean they don't need to learn some Internet safety lessons from Mom and Dad. Talk to them about not sharing personal information or clicking on suspicious links. |

The Quantum LTO 3 Proved Best Over The Last Few Years
Quantum is another company that produces LTO tapes. This Quantum product, the MR-L3MQN-01 is an LTO-3 tape. The MR-L3MQN-01 has a 400 GB native and 800 GB compressed capacity. Transfer rates applicable to the MR-L3MQN-01 LTO-3 tape media are 80 MB/s native and 160 MB/s compressed. The MR-L3MQN-01 is compatible with LTO-3 and LTO-4 tape media, it is not however compatible with LTO-1 and LTO-2 tape drives. The MR-L3MQN-01 also features the LTO-CM which allows for data storage usage statistics, etc

The HP LTO 1 Gives Extraordinary Performance And It's Really Helpful
HP C7971A LTO-1 Tape has a tape length of 609m which enables a native data storage capacity of 100GB that can be expanded up to 200GB when compressed. It features the use of LTO Cartridge Memory for fast access to data and enhanced manageability of data and the back up process. The HP C7971A LTO1 tape cartridge can last for up to 1,000,000 head passes.

Blu-Ray set to take the world by storm!
The Blu-ray Disc belongs to a new generation of optical discs capable of staging high density data. Blu-Ray technology is based on a blue-violet coloured laser. The blue laser operates at a wave length of 405 nm, while older technology such as DVDs and CDs are based on red and infrared lasers that works at 650 and 780 nm. Since the wave length is shorter with a blue laser, the new Blu-ray technology makes is possible to store much more information
